Sainte-Honorine-la-Guillaume is a commune in the Orne department in north-western France.
History[]
- 1620: Georges Pierre is the vicar of this parish.
- 1622: Jean Le Corsonnois is curate and François Guérin "parish priest".
- 1622: "Mr Guillaume Lesage, squire, gentleman of la Bocherie and of the Rocher de Sainte-Honorine(la Guillaume)". His son is Jacques Lesage.
Administration[]
Serge Clérembaux was mayor between 1971 and 2020. Pierre Madeline was elected mayor in 2020.[2]

People linked with the commune[]
Hans-Joachim Klein, a former German terrorist, who belonged to the Vienna commando in December 1975, was arrested at Sainte-Honorine in September 1998 where he had lived for several years. He was sentenced to nine years' imprisonment in Germany in January 2001 for the murder of an Iraqi security agent in 1975. He later benefitted from a pardon and returned to Sainte-Honorine-le-Guillaume.[4]
